API files update.
This commit is contained in:
parent
296c5a6b97
commit
05fffb15ec
|
@ -218,10 +218,18 @@ dlls/msacm
|
|||
|
||||
dlls/msacm/imaadp32
|
||||
|
||||
% dlls/msacm/msg711/msg711.drv.spec
|
||||
% dlls/msacm/msadp32/msadp32.acm.spec
|
||||
|
||||
dlls/msacm/msadp32
|
||||
|
||||
% dlls/msacm/msg711/msg711.acm.spec
|
||||
|
||||
dlls/msacm/msg711
|
||||
|
||||
% dlls/msacm/winemp3/winemp3.acm.spec
|
||||
|
||||
dlls/msacm/winemp3
|
||||
|
||||
% dlls/msnet32/msnet32.spec
|
||||
|
||||
% dlls/msvideo/msvfw32.spec
|
||||
|
|
|
@ -107,6 +107,8 @@ LPMODULEENTRY32
|
|||
LPOVERLAPPED
|
||||
LPOVERLAPPED *
|
||||
LPOVERLAPPED_COMPLETION_ROUTINE
|
||||
LPOSVERSIONINFOEXA
|
||||
LPOSVERSIONINFOEXW
|
||||
LPPROCESSENTRY32
|
||||
LPPROCESS_HEAP_ENTRY
|
||||
LPPROCESS_INFORMATION
|
||||
|
|
|
@ -1 +1,7 @@
|
|||
%long
|
||||
|
||||
DWORD
|
||||
HDRVR
|
||||
LPARAM
|
||||
LRESULT
|
||||
UINT
|
||||
|
|
|
@ -34,7 +34,7 @@ WCHAR
|
|||
|
||||
%long --extension
|
||||
|
||||
handle_t
|
||||
obj_handle_t
|
||||
|
||||
%long # --forbidden
|
||||
|
||||
|
@ -115,6 +115,7 @@ void *
|
|||
WCHAR *
|
||||
char *
|
||||
enum fd_type *
|
||||
obj_handle_t *
|
||||
int *
|
||||
|
||||
%str
|
||||
|
|
|
@ -18,9 +18,14 @@ UINT_PTR
|
|||
|
||||
BYTE *
|
||||
DWORD *
|
||||
GUID *
|
||||
INFCONTEXT *
|
||||
INT *
|
||||
PBYTE
|
||||
PDWORD
|
||||
PSP_DEVICE_INTERFACE_DATA
|
||||
PSP_DEVICE_INTERFACE_DETAIL_DATAA
|
||||
PSP_DEVICE_INTERFACE_DETAIL_DATAW
|
||||
PSP_DEVINFO_DATA
|
||||
PSP_FILE_CALLBACK_A
|
||||
PSP_FILE_CALLBACK_W
|
||||
|
@ -33,6 +38,7 @@ UINT *
|
|||
|
||||
%str
|
||||
|
||||
LPCSTR
|
||||
PCSTR
|
||||
PCWSTR
|
||||
PWSTR
|
||||
|
|
|
@ -8,7 +8,6 @@ INT
|
|||
HDC
|
||||
HBITMAP
|
||||
HFONT
|
||||
HGDIOBJ
|
||||
HRGN
|
||||
HWND
|
||||
LONG
|
||||
|
@ -31,6 +30,7 @@ CREATESTRUCTA *
|
|||
LPBYTE
|
||||
LPCVOID
|
||||
LPINT
|
||||
LPPALETTEENTRY
|
||||
LPSIZE
|
||||
LPTEXTMETRICW
|
||||
INT *
|
||||
|
|
|
@ -23,7 +23,6 @@ HHOOK
|
|||
HICON
|
||||
HINSTANCE
|
||||
HKL
|
||||
HPEN
|
||||
HMENU
|
||||
HMONITOR
|
||||
HRESULT
|
||||
|
|
|
@ -0,0 +1,7 @@
|
|||
%long
|
||||
|
||||
DWORD
|
||||
HDRVR
|
||||
LPARAM
|
||||
LRESULT
|
||||
UINT
|
|
@ -9,8 +9,8 @@ HBITMAP
|
|||
HBRUSH
|
||||
HDC
|
||||
HFONT
|
||||
HGDIOBJ
|
||||
HICON
|
||||
HPALETTE
|
||||
HPEN
|
||||
HRGN
|
||||
HWND
|
||||
|
@ -41,6 +41,7 @@ LPBYTE
|
|||
LPCVOID
|
||||
LPINT
|
||||
LPLOGFONTW
|
||||
LPPALETTEENTRY
|
||||
LPPOINT
|
||||
LPRECT
|
||||
LPSIZE
|
||||
|
|
|
@ -560,7 +560,7 @@ sub parse_c_file {
|
|||
(?:(?:const\s+|enum\s+|long\s+|signed\s+|short\s+|struct\s+|union\s+|unsigned\s+)*?)
|
||||
(\w+(?:\s*\*+\s*)?)\s+
|
||||
(?:(\w+)\s*)?
|
||||
\((?:(\w+)\s+)?\s*\*\s*(\w+)\s*\)\s*
|
||||
\((?:(\w+)\s*)?\s*\*\s*(\w+)\s*\)\s*
|
||||
(?:\(([^\)]*)\)|\[([^\]]*)\])\s*;/sx)
|
||||
{
|
||||
$_ = $'; $again = 1;
|
||||
|
|
Loading…
Reference in New Issue